Zhengyan Chang is a researcher specializing in intelligent transportation systems and automation, with a particular focus on the application of artificial potential field methods to industrial machinery. Their most-cited work, "Route planning of intelligent bridge cranes based on an improved artificial potential field method" (2021, 11 citations), pioneers the adaptation of path planning algorithms—traditionally used for driverless cars and mobile robots—to the obstacle avoidance and autonomous navigation of bridge cranes. This contribution addresses a critical gap in industrial automation, enhancing safety and efficiency in material handling. By refining the artificial potential field method to account for crane-specific constraints, Chang has opened new avenues for smart manufacturing and logistics.
